What is considered animal neglect in Oregon?

A person who intentionally, knowingly, recklessly or with criminal negligence fails to provide minimum care to an animal in the person’s custody or control has committed animal neglect in the second degree. Additionally, injury of an animal resulting from tethering is also animal neglect in the second degree.

How many dogs can you own in Clackamas County Oregon?

As of December 2012 Clackamas County has no limit on the number of dogs one may own, as long as minimum care standards are met for all dogs on the property at all times.

What is the difference between animal abuse and neglect?

Intentional cruelty means someone has purposely inflicted physical harm or injury on an animal. Unintentional cruelty, or neglect, could mean an animal has been denied the basic necessities of care, including food, water, shelter, or veterinary care.

What are the 3 types of animal cruelty?

Data collection covers four categories: simple/gross neglect, intentional abuse and torture, organized abuse (such as dogfighting and cockfighting) and animal sexual abuse.

Can I have a rooster in Clackamas County?

Chickens and roosters are allowed in all rural areas of the county, but there are restrictions in urban areas and/or residential zoning districts.
